English Literature MCQs Set 4

191. The line “To be or not to be” comes from which play?

a. Macbeth
b. Twelfth Night
c. A Midsummer Night’s dream
d. Hamlet

192. Was the Globe…

a. A Roman Amphitheater.
b. An Elizabethan Theater.
c. An Elizabethan sports stadium.
d. A famous map of the world.

193. Which of these was not one of Shakespeare’s plays?

a. Titus Andronicus 
b. The Tempest
c. Cymbeline 
d. Shakespeare in love

194. How many times suicide occurs in Shakespeare’s plays?

a. 7
b. 9
c. 11
d. 13

195. Which famous Shakespeare play does the quote,”My salad days, when I was green in judgment.” come from?

a. Antony and Cleopatra 
b. Hamlet, Prince of Denmark
c. The Winters Tale 
d. The Merry Wives of Windsor

196. Which famous Shakespeare play does the quote,”Neither a borrower nor a lender be” come from?

a. Cymbeline 
b. Hamlet
c. Titus Andronicus 
d. Pericles, Prince of Tyre 

197. In what year was the First Folio published?

a. 1626 
b. 1621
c. 1623
d. 1629

198. What nationality was Shakespeare?

a. Italian 
b. English
c. Scottish 
d. Greek

199. In which century was Shakespeare born?

a. 16th 
b. 14th
c. 15th 
d. 17th

200. Which famous Shakespeare play does the quote “The first thing we do, let’s kill all the lawyers” come from?

a. The Merry Wives of Windsor 
b. Othello, the Moor of Venice
c. Pericles, Prince of Tyre 
d. King Henry the Sixth, Part II
